As a Layer 2 managed switch, the Cisco Industrial Ethernet 3010 IE-3010-24TC determines its role through IEEE 802.1Q VLAN segmentation, Spanning Tree protocols (STP, RSTP, MSTP), and Cisco Resilient Ethernet Protocol (REP) for industrial redundancy—capabilities essential for network engineers and IT infrastructure teams deploying hardened switching in demanding environments. The IE-3010-24TC combines 24 × 10/100BASE-T RJ-45 copper ports with 2 × Gigabit Ethernet combo SFP uplink ports (shared), delivering 26 total ports in a compact, fanless DIN rail form factor. Running Cisco IOS, this industrial-grade switch supports up to 255 active VLANs and implements quality-of-service features including IEEE 802.1p Class of Service, DSCP marking, and 4 egress queues per port for traffic prioritization.
Built for extreme operational conditions, the IE-3010-24TC operates reliably from −40°C to +85°C across a wide power input range of 88–300V AC or 60–300V DC with dual redundant power inputs supported, consuming approximately 26W at maximum load. At 346 × 44 × 225 mm, this switch maintains industrial standards compliance with IEEE 1613 Class 2 and IEC 61850-3 certification, ensuring suitability for utility substations, manufacturing plants, and critical infrastructure deployments. Humidity tolerance of 5% to 95% non-condensing further reinforces its industrial credentials.
